Click Rate vs. VTR : Grasping Internet Data Points

When analyzing the impact of your promotional efforts, it’s crucial to distinguish between CTR percentage and view-through rate (VTR) . Basically, a click rate measures the ratio of users who, after viewing your ad or link, proceed to click it. It's a direct indication of how compelling your creative and targeting are. However, a VTR tracks individuals who, without interacting directly (i.e., not tapping on) the ad, subsequently convert – for example, making a purchase or finishing a desired action. A high VTR suggests your brand messaging had an impression and drove future behavior, even if it didn't result in an immediate click .

  • CTR focuses on immediate action.
  • VTR highlights delayed impact.
  • Both offer valuable insights into user behavior.
So, analyzing both measurements provides a more complete picture of your campaign's overall reach.
